پروتکل HTTP یکی از مهمترین پروتکلهای اینترنتی است که بهعنوان استانداردی برای انتقال دادهها بین کلاینت (مانند مرورگر وب) و سرور مورد استفاده قرار میگیرد.
HTTP از معماری Request-Response استفاده میکند، به این صورت که کلاینت یک Request به سرور ارسال میکند و سرور پس از پردازش درخواست، Response که شامل دادههای مورد نظر مانند متن، تصویر یا ویدیو است را بازمیگرداند.
پروتکل HTTP در زمینه تست نفوذ وب اهمیت بسیار زیادی دارد، زیرا اساس ارتباطات در برنامههای وب است و درک دقیق آن برای شناسایی و بهرهبرداری از آسیبپذیریهای امنیتی ضروری است.
تست نفوذ وب، بر تحلیل و بررسی درخواستها و پاسخهای HTTP تمرکز دارد تا بوسیله آن بتوان نقاط ضعف موجود در برنامههای وب را شناسایی کرد.
از آنجایی که تعامل کاربران و سرورها از طریق این پروتکل انجام میشود، تحلیل دادههای انتقالی، هدرها، پارامترها و کوکیها نقش کلیدی در شناسایی آسیبپذیریهایی مانند SQL Injection، Cross-Site Scripting (XSS)، و Cross-Site Request Forgery (CSRF) ایفا میکند.
در این چالش که به صورت پرسش و پاسخ طراحی شده است، قصد داریم تا شما را با پروتکل HTTP بیشتر آشنا نماییم.
شما ابتدا می بایست فایل PDF این چالش را دانلود نموده و پس از مطالعه آن به سوالات چالش پاسخ دهید.
درصد پیشرفت حل چالش
0%